Latest Patents

Graeber holds a patent for a "Fluid delivery pipe with leak detection." This invention features a secondary containment system designed to contain fuel leaks or leaks of other environmentally hazardous fluids. The system includes a containment chamber and a detection system that identifies leaks. It consists of a fluid-carrying inner pipe surrounded by a containment pipe, creating an interstitial space for leak containment. This interstitial space is pressurized with an inert fluid at a constant pressure greater than that of the fluid flowing through the inner pipe. Monitoring the pressure of the inert fluid triggers an alarm if a leak occurs, and the location of the leak can be determined using multiple pressure sensors. The containment pipe is reinforced to withstand pressures of at least 75 psi. Graeber's innovative approach enhances safety and environmental protection in fluid delivery systems.
